IsolatedStorageFileStream.Write Metod

Definition

Överlagringar

Name Description
Write(ReadOnlySpan<Byte>)

Skriver ett byteblock till det isolerade lagringsfilströmsobjektet med data som lästs från en buffert som består av ett skrivskyddat byteintervall.

Write(Byte[], Int32, Int32)

Skriver ett byteblock till det isolerade lagringsfilströmobjektet med data som lästs från en buffert som består av en bytematris.

Write(ReadOnlySpan<Byte>)

Skriver ett byteblock till det isolerade lagringsfilströmsobjektet med data som lästs från en buffert som består av ett skrivskyddat byteintervall.

public:
 override void Write(ReadOnlySpan<System::Byte> buffer);
public override void Write(ReadOnlySpan<byte> buffer);
override this.Write : ReadOnlySpan<byte> -> unit
Public Overrides Sub Write (buffer As ReadOnlySpan(Of Byte))

Parametrar

buffer
ReadOnlySpan<Byte>

Det skrivskyddade byteintervallet som byte kopieras från till den aktuella isolerade lagringsfilströmmen.

Gäller för

Write(Byte[], Int32, Int32)

Skriver ett byteblock till det isolerade lagringsfilströmobjektet med data som lästs från en buffert som består av en bytematris.

public:
 override void Write(cli::array <System::Byte> ^ buffer, int offset, int count);
public override void Write(byte[] buffer, int offset, int count);
override this.Write : byte[] * int * int -> unit
Public Overrides Sub Write (buffer As Byte(), offset As Integer, count As Integer)

Parametrar

buffer
Byte[]

Bytematrisen som byte ska kopieras från till den aktuella isolerade lagringsfilströmmen.

offset
Int32

Byteförskjutningen buffer som ska börjas från.

count
Int32

Det maximala antalet byte som ska skrivas.

Undantag

Skrivförsöket överskrider kvoten för IsolatedStorageFileStream objektet.

Kommentarer

Om skrivåtgärden lyckas avanceras objektets IsolatedStorageFileStream aktuella position av antalet skrivna byte. Om ett undantag inträffar ändras objektets IsolatedStorageFileStream aktuella position.

Gäller för